Step 4: Migrating the spooler service. The Quillback print-spooler microservice replaces the legacy daemon on the Harstow cluster. It accepts the same job payloads but queues them in Redis instead of on disk, so no filesystem permissions are needed. Drain the old daemon first, then register Quillback with the routing mesh. Once registration succeeds, apply the configuration below before enabling traffic:

config for hahaf-kafof:
[wenys]
host = wenys.torvahq.corp
user = wenys_svc
database = wenys_prod

Subject: Varnholt licensing dispute — status

Executive team,

For the incoming director: Varnholt Systems alleges our Cindral module exceeds the seat count in the 2022 agreement. Counsel disputes their audit method. Exposure estimate pending; settlement talks resume Thursday in Drelburg. Do not discuss externally. Legal owns all correspondence; route inquiries to them. We will brief the board only after counsel's memo lands. The strategic implications for next year's roadmap are summarized in the confidential note below.

confidential, bahap-bajog: Zorethix Works is in early talks to buy Kelethox Foods for about $30.7 million. The Ralvan launch date is September 19, and nothing goes to the press before then.

// MAX_WEBHOOK_RETRY_WINDOW_SECS
// This constant bounds how long the Cartwheel parcel-tracking service
// will retry delivery of a webhook to a merchant endpoint. Carriers in
// the Velden network sometimes emit duplicate scan events hours apart,
// so we cap retries at this window to avoid replaying stale statuses.
// New team members: do not raise this without checking the dedupe
// cache TTL, which must always exceed it. The build that last tuned
// this value is noted below.

pipeline stamp: htk9_ce63042d9